Soil-specific limitations for access and analysis of soil microbial communities by metagenomics.
FEMS microbiology ecology - 1 Oct 2011
Lombard Nathalie, Prestat Emmanuel, van Elsas Jan Dirk, Simonet Pascal
Abstract excerpt
Metagenomics approaches represent an important way to acquire information on the microbial communities present in complex environments like soil. However, to what extent do these approaches provide us with a true picture of soil microbial diversity? Soil is a challenging environment to work with. Its physicochemical properties affect microbial distributions inside the soil matrix, metagenome extraction and its...
